Abdusalom Azizov replaces Ikhtiyor Abdullayev as State Security Service head
The head of the State Security Service, Ikhtiyor Abdullayev, resigned from his post, Kun.uz correspondent reports.
In turn, Lieutenant-General Abdusalom Azizov has been appointed head of the SSS.

Ikhtiyor Abdullayev was born on May 22, 1966 in the Uchkuprik district of the Fergana region. From 1985 to 1990, he studied law at Perm State University.

He began his professional career in the Fergana City Court, where during his studies at the university he worked as a judicial executor, and after receiving his diploma, he was promoted to the post of judge.
From April 21, 2015 to January 31, 2018, he held the post of Prosecutor General of Uzbekistan. He is a state counselor of justice of the second class.
In January 2018, he was appointed head of the State Security Service.
